Skip to content

Commit d356d14

Browse files
committed
Remove empty comment line in Activator.java
Update OSGi dependencies and replace Properties with Hashtable in Activator Add JDK 21 and JDK 25 test runners Update dependencies
1 parent d2073be commit d356d14

File tree

6 files changed

+11
-10
lines changed

6 files changed

+11
-10
lines changed

.github/workflows/main.yml

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-4,6 +4,7 @@ on:
44
push:
55
branches:
66
- '*'
7+
- 'origin/*'
78
pull_request:
89
branches:
910
- '*'
@@ -26,7 +27,7 @@ jobs:
2627
runs-on: ${{ matrix.os }}
2728
strategy:
2829
matrix:
29-
jdk: [11, 17, 19]
30+
jdk: [11, 17, 19, 21, 25]
3031
os: [ubuntu-latest, windows-latest, macos-latest]
3132
fail-fast: true
3233
max-parallel: 4

integration/pom.xml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-53,7 +53,7 @@
5353
<dependency>
5454
<groupId>org.apache.felix</groupId>
5555
<artifactId>org.apache.felix.main</artifactId>
56-
<version>5.6.1</version>
56+
<version>7.0.5</version>
5757
<!--<version>2.0.2</version>-->
5858
</dependency>
5959
</dependencies>

osgi-over-slf4j/pom.xml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-25,13 +25,13 @@
2525
<dependency>
2626
<groupId>org.osgi</groupId>
2727
<artifactId>org.osgi.core</artifactId>
28-
<version>4.2.0</version>
28+
<version>6.0.0</version>
2929
<scope>provided</scope>
3030
</dependency>
3131
<dependency>
3232
<groupId>org.osgi</groupId>
3333
<artifactId>org.osgi.enterprise</artifactId>
34-
<version>4.2.0</version>
34+
<version>5.0.0</version>
3535
<scope>provided</scope>
3636
</dependency>
3737

osgi-over-slf4j/src/main/java/org/slf4j/osgi/logservice/impl/Activator.java

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-32,7 +32,7 @@
3232

3333
package org.slf4j.osgi.logservice.impl;
3434

35-
import java.util.Properties;
35+
import java.util.Hashtable;
3636

3737
import org.osgi.framework.BundleActivator;
3838
import org.osgi.framework.BundleContext;
@@ -57,7 +57,7 @@ public class Activator implements BundleActivator {
5757
*/
5858
public void start(BundleContext bundleContext) throws Exception {
5959

60-
Properties props = new Properties();
60+
Hashtable<String, String> props = new Hashtable<>();
6161
props.put("description", "An SLF4J LogService implementation.");
6262
ServiceFactory factory = new LogServiceFactory();
6363
bundleContext.registerService(LogService.class.getName(), factory, props);

parent/pom.xml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-37,10 +37,10 @@
3737
<project.reporting.outputEncoding>UTF-8</project.reporting.outputEncoding>
3838
<!-- used in integration testing -->
3939
<cal10n.version>0.8.1</cal10n.version>
40-
<reload4j.version>1.2.22</reload4j.version>
40+
<reload4j.version>1.2.26</reload4j.version>
4141
<logback.version>1.2.10</logback.version>
4242
<jcl.version>1.2</jcl.version>
43-
<junit.version>4.13.1</junit.version>
43+
<junit.version>4.13.2</junit.version>
4444
<maven-site-plugin.version>3.7.1</maven-site-plugin.version>
4545
<maven-compiler-plugin.version>3.10.1</maven-compiler-plugin.version>
4646
<maven-surefire-plugin.version>3.0.0-M7</maven-surefire-plugin.version>

slf4j-ext/pom.xml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-36,9 +36,9 @@
3636
<optional>true</optional>
3737
</dependency>
3838
<dependency>
39-
<groupId>javassist</groupId>
39+
<groupId>org.javassist</groupId>
4040
<artifactId>javassist</artifactId>
41-
<version>3.4.GA</version>
41+
<version>3.30.2-GA</version>
4242
<optional>true</optional>
4343
</dependency>
4444
</dependencies>

0 commit comments

Comments
 (0)